#include "Capability.hpp"
#include "RuntimeEnvironment.hpp"
#include "Identity.hpp"
#include "Topology.hpp"
#include "Switch.hpp"
namespace ZeroTier {
int Capability::verify(const RuntimeEnvironment *RR) const
{
try {
Buffer<(sizeof(Capability) * 2)> tmp;
this->serialize(tmp,true);
for(unsigned int c=0;c<ZT_MAX_CAPABILITY_CUSTODY_CHAIN_LENGTH;++c) {
if (!_custody[c].to)
return ((c == 0) ? -1 : 0);
if (!_custody[c].from)
return -1;
const Identity id(RR->topology->getIdentity(_custody[c].from));
if (id) {
if (!id.verify(tmp.data(),tmp.size(),_custody[c].signature))
return -1;
} else {
RR->sw->requestWhois(_custody[c].from);
return 1;
}
}
return 0;
} catch ( ... ) {
return -1;
}
}
} // namespace ZeroTier
